BMW 31351091496 Stabilizer Bar Link

BMW 31351091496 Stabilizer Bar Link

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• BMW31351091496
  • BMW31351095695

Similar Products

FDL7001

FIRST LINE FDL7001 Stabilizer Bar Link

K750172

Airtex K750172 Stabilizer Bar Link

GS30813

MEVOTECH GS30813 Stabilizer Bar Link

TC1389

DELPHI TC1389 Stabilizer Bar Link

K90714

QUICK STEER K90714 Stabilizer Bar Link

MBL619

DEEZA MBL619 Stabilizer Bar Link

46G0252A

ACDELCO 46G0252A Stabilizer Bar Link

1017397

BECK/ARNLEY 1017397 Stabilizer Bar Link

SS4048

FAI SS4048 Stabilizer Bar Link

27262

FEBI 27262 Stabilizer Bar Link

1017401

BECK/ARNLEY 1017401 Stabilizer Bar Link

ACL639

DEEZA ACL639 Stabilizer Bar Link